Botox functions by initially impeding signals sent from nerves to the facial muscles, helping to reduce tension in the muscles and lessen the appearance of a down-turned mouth. Generally, the procedure is swift and effortless, with results visible in a few days, the greatest effect occurring after two weeks.

Botox injections are a successful way to reduce Downward Turned Mouth. An effective and safe toxin is used to paralyse the muscles that form the Downward Turned Mouth.
